Output 73b4e367dcce7cbb5fe39455dc6558fd0906bf3f05ba99406f89ffda6c05576d:0

value
143986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5dcaa767456c1d99e909d6a59245f72f44a0782 OP_EQUAL
address
3MBpCY6xJ8J6drjxFZNNwunkgC2ykZiYdJ
transaction
73b4e367dcce7cbb5fe39455dc6558fd0906bf3f05ba99406f89ffda6c05576d
confirmations
96828
spent
true